What Are the Most Common Types of Muzzles Used for Dogs?

The most common types of muzzles used for dogs include:

  • Basket Muzzle: A basket muzzle is designed to allow a dog to pant, drink, and take treats while preventing biting or chewing. It is typically made from sturdy materials like plastic or metal and is ideal for dogs that may eat everything they find on the ground, as it prevents them from scavenging.
  • Soft Muzzle: Soft muzzles are made from fabric or mesh and are designed to fit snugly around a dog’s mouth. While they do restrict the dog’s ability to open their mouth fully, they are often used for short durations, like vet visits, rather than for longer periods, making them less suitable for dogs that tend to eat everything.
  • Plastic Muzzle: Generally lightweight and easy to clean, plastic muzzles are molded to fit securely around a dog’s nose and mouth. They provide a balance between comfort and safety, effectively preventing dogs from eating unwanted items while allowing some level of airflow.
  • Leather Muzzle: Leather muzzles are durable and provide a classic look while being comfortable for the dog. They can be adjusted for a snug fit, and while they restrict the dog’s ability to eat or chew, they are often used for training and socialization purposes.
  • Head Halter Muzzle: This type of muzzle combines a head halter with a muzzle, allowing for better control of the dog while preventing it from biting or eating things off the ground. This design is useful for strong dogs who are likely to pull or lunge, as it provides greater control during walks.

What Key Features Should You Look for in a Muzzle for Dogs That Eat Everything?

When searching for the best muzzle for dogs that eat everything, consider the following key features:

  • Material: The muzzle should be made of durable, non-toxic materials that can withstand chewing and are comfortable for your dog. Look for options that incorporate breathable fabrics or soft padding to prevent chafing and irritation while ensuring longevity.
  • Design: A well-designed muzzle should allow for panting, drinking, and even eating small treats while still preventing your dog from consuming harmful objects. Choose a design that fits securely but doesn’t restrict your dog’s normal movements or facial expressions.
  • Size and Fit: Proper sizing is crucial to ensure that the muzzle stays in place without being too tight or loose. Measure your dog’s snout according to the manufacturer’s size guide to find the best fit, as an ill-fitting muzzle can cause discomfort or be easily removed by your dog.
  • Adjustability: Look for muzzles that offer adjustable straps or secure fastening options, which help to customize the fit for various dog breeds and snout shapes. Adjustable features can enhance comfort and prevent the muzzle from slipping off during walks or outings.
  • Ease of Cleaning: Since muzzles can become dirty, especially in outdoor environments, choose one that is easy to clean or machine washable. This ensures your dog can wear a fresh, hygienic muzzle without hassle.
  • Visibility: A muzzle with reflective elements or bright colors can enhance safety during walks, especially in low-light conditions. This feature can help keep both you and your dog visible to others, reducing the chances of accidents.
  • Weight: The muzzle should be lightweight so that your dog can wear it comfortably for extended periods without feeling weighed down. Heavy muzzles can lead to fatigue or discomfort, prompting your dog to resist wearing it.

How Can You Train Your Dog to Wear a Muzzle Comfortably?

Training your dog to wear a muzzle comfortably involves several key steps to ensure both safety and well-being.

  • Choosing the Right Muzzle: Selecting the best muzzle for dogs that eat everything is crucial for comfort. A muzzle that fits well allows for panting and drinking while preventing your dog from scavenging harmful items.
  • Positive Reinforcement: Use treats and praise to create a positive association with the muzzle. Gradually introduce the muzzle by allowing your dog to sniff it and rewarding them for calm behavior.
  • Gradual Desensitization: Slowly acclimate your dog to wearing the muzzle for short periods. Start by placing it on them for a few seconds and gradually increase the duration over several sessions, ensuring your dog remains calm.
  • Practice with the Muzzle On: Once your dog is comfortable wearing the muzzle, practice walking and other activities while they wear it. This helps them understand that wearing a muzzle can be a normal part of their routine.
  • Monitor Your Dog’s Behavior: Keep a close eye on your dog’s reactions during the training process. If they show signs of distress or discomfort, take a step back and give them more time to adjust before proceeding.
  • Regular Breaks: Ensure your dog has regular breaks without the muzzle during training sessions. This helps prevent frustration and allows them to associate the muzzle with short, manageable experiences.
